Mary Magdalene in the Bible: Her Story, Role, and Lessons for Today

Mary Magdalene is one of the most significant and enigmatic figures in the New Testament, her story unfolding through several key moments in the Gospels

Often misunderstood, she is portrayed as both a devoted follower of Jesus and a witness to some of the most pivotal events in Christian history. Her narrative carries lessons of faith, redemption, and the transformative power of Jesus’ love.

Mary Magdalene is first introduced in the Gospel of Luke (8:2), where she is identified as a woman from whom Jesus cast out seven demons. This initial encounter highlights the depth of her suffering and the miraculous power of Jesus. 

After this, she became one of Jesus’ most faithful followers, supporting Him and His ministry. Her transformation from a woman tormented by demons to a devoted disciple is a powerful testament to Jesus’ healing and redemptive power.

In the Gospels, Mary Magdalene’s role becomes even more prominent as she is present during key moments in the Passion of Christ. She stands at the foot of the cross as Jesus is crucified, alongside other women and the apostle John (John 19:25). 

This demonstrates her unwavering loyalty and courage, as she remains with Jesus even when His other disciples had scattered in fear.

Perhaps the most significant moment in Mary Magdalene’s story comes after the resurrection of Jesus. On the morning of the third day, she goes to Jesus’ tomb, only to find it empty. Distraught and confused, she encounters a man whom she believes to be the gardener. 

When He speaks her name, “Mary,” she recognizes Him as Jesus (John 20:16). In this profound moment, Mary becomes the first person to witness the risen Christ. Jesus entrusts her with the message of His resurrection, instructing her to go and tell His disciples (John 20:17).

Mary Magdalene’s story teaches us valuable lessons about faith, redemption, and the role of women in God’s kingdom. Her transformation from a woman possessed by demons to the first witness of Jesus’ resurrection underscores the power of divine intervention and the possibility of a new beginning. 

Her unwavering loyalty, even in the face of suffering, is an example of the deep love and devotion that believers are called to have for Christ.

Her role also highlights the importance of women in the Gospel narrative. In a time when women were often marginalized, Mary Magdalene’s close relationship with Jesus and her role in spreading the good news of His resurrection demonstrate that God values all people, regardless of their past. 

She serves as an example to all believers that no one is beyond redemption, and that, through faith in Jesus, everyone can experience new life. Her narrative also reminds us of the essential role that each of us plays in spreading the message of the Gospel, just as she did, by sharing the good news of Christ’s resurrection with the world.
